Hard hats are NOT designed to protect you from electrical shock. Is this statement True or False?

Explanation:
Hard hats can be protective against electrical shocks if they are specifically rated for electrical insulation. There are models designed for electrical protection (commonly Class G and Class E); these provide dielectric protection up to certain voltage levels. Other hats (Class C) offer no electrical protection and only shield against impact. So the statement is false because some hard hats are designed to protect against electrical shock, while others are not. Always check the hat’s rating and use only those approved for electrical work, and inspect for damage or wear that could compromise protection.

What types of equipment are commonly included in supply chain automation?

Supply chain automation typically involves equipment like automated guided vehicles (AGVs), conveyor systems, robotics, and barcode scanners. These technologies enhance efficiency by streamlining processes.
